Simplified Snake Basket. Colon: Abbotts Magic, ca. 1965. A faux snake is thrown in a woven basket along with a pack of cards. After comedic by-play, the snake rises from the basket with a selected card in its mouth. Basket 9 _ high. Battery operated model. With wooden carrying case and accessories. For decades, the baskets for the magic tricks manufactured by Abbotts (this one included) were woven by a local Potawatomi Indian tribe in southeastern Michigan, not far from the magic companys headquarters.
